TMC is the leader in precision floor vibration isolation technology serving major research centers, OEM and end-user semiconductor manufacturers, university research laboratories, drug discovery companies, and nanotechnology labs. We are actively seeking qualified candidates as a Production Welder.   The Production Welder will weld a variety of metal components and finish parts to print. The work is 50% MIG and 50% TIG. The welder will work with a variety of materials to include: Light gauge steel, stainless steel, or aluminum.   The successful candidate should have 3-5 years prior experience and be familiar with the safe use of basic hand and power tools, such as grinders and deburring equipment along with the safe use of hoists and pallett jacks. Must be able to understand and follow welding and assembly prints. The candidate must be able to work with minimal supervision around other welders in a production ISO environment. The manufacturing facility has all safety measures in place. The work can be physical and require the movement of metal up to 50 pounds, standing, reaching, and frequent bending.
